New Listing! Calming 2BR near park, Herne Hill
London - 114 Herne Hill Road
New Listing! Calming 2BR near park, Herne Hill is located in the Lambeth district of London, 5.7 km from Westminster Abbey, 5.7 km from Waterloo Station and 5.8 km from Big Ben. The property is6 km from Houses of Parliament, 6.2 km from Churchill War Rooms and 6.2 km from Victoria Train Station. The property is non-smoking and is situated 1.6 km from O2 Academy Brixton.The spacious apartment has 2 bedrooms, a flat-screen TV, a fully equipped kitchen with an oven and a microwave, a washing machine, and 1 bathroom with a bath. Towels and bed linen are available in the apartment. There is also a seating ...








































